|
|
|
Просмотр .BMP
|
|||
|---|---|---|---|
|
#18+
Здравствуйте. Используется связка MSSQL2000(SP4)+VFP8(SP1). На SQLServer в поле типа image хрантся изображения в формате BMP. Другие форматы не используются. Доступ к данным осуществляется через remote view. Для работы с полем в VFP доступ к нему предоставляется как к типу GENERAL или MEMO Binary. Подскажите с помощью какого контрола (предпочтительно с ControlSource) вывевсти изображение на экран на клиенте в VFP. Спасибо.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 16.09.2005, 15:22:27 |
|
||
|
Просмотр .BMP
|
|||
|---|---|---|---|
|
#18+
Hi vklepko! > Доступ к данным осуществляется через remote view. > Для работы с полем в VFP доступ к нему предоставляется как к типу GENERAL > или MEMO Binary. Нужно именно memo (binary). General предполагает наличие в содержимом специальной служебной информации (о типе данных, о том какое приложение должно отображать/обрабатывать эти данные) - естественно что в MSSQL этой информации нету. Да и вообще от неё больше вреда чем пользы - предположим например что такого приложения нет на одной из систем - в лучшем случае получим "иконку" щёлкнув по которой фокс попытается найти хоть какое-то приложение, совместимое с хранящимися в поле данными. > Подскажите с помощью какого контрола (предпочтительно с ControlSource) > вывевсти изображение на экран на клиенте в VFP. Не знаю я такого в VFP8 - наверное только сохранив в tmp файл и загрузив в Image через .Picture Возможно имеются ActiveX которые это могут, но очень сомнительно что они могут работать по схеме типа ControlSource, разве что специально под фокс написанные. В VFP9 уже можно в Image напрямую гнать бинарный поток картинки - но опять таки не через ControlSource, а через свойство PictureVal... Posted via ActualForum NNTP Server 1.3 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.09.2005, 20:54:44 |
|
||
|
Просмотр .BMP
|
|||
|---|---|---|---|
|
#18+
>>Подскажите с помощью какого контрола (предпочтительно с ControlSource) вывевсти изображение на экран на клиенте в VFP. В 7 и 8 я использовал LEAD Control 2.0 Это компонент из набора Active-x компании LEAD Tehnologi Набор компонентов называется Lead Tools Я пользовался версией Lead Tools 12 Medical. Сейчас есть версия 13, но, говорят, она медленнее работает. А в 9 я использую объект Image. У него, конечно, нет такого количества возможностей как у LEAD Control, но мне большего не нужно))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.09.2005, 14:17:47 |
|
||
|
|

start [/forum/topic.php?fid=41&msg=33276698&tid=1593369]: |
0ms |
get settings: |
5ms |
get forum list: |
12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
201ms |
get topic data: |
7ms |
get forum data: |
2ms |
get page messages: |
29ms |
get tp. blocked users: |
1ms |
| others: | 219ms |
| total: | 482ms |

| 0 / 0 |
